Colossal Cave Adventure (also known as Adventure or ADVENT) is a text-based adventure game, released in 1976 by Will Crowther for the PDP-10 mainframe computer. It was expanded upon in 1977 by Don Woods. In the game, the player explores a cave system rumored to be filled with treasure and gold. The game is composed of dozens of locations, and the player…
